php丢失怎么解决
-
PHP丢失是指在使用PHP语言开发过程中出现了某种问题导致PHP代码失效或无法执行的情况。下面将介绍一些常见的PHP丢失问题以及解决方法。
一、常见的PHP丢失问题:
1. PHP函数不可用:有时候我们在代码中调用某个PHP函数时,却发现函数无法正常使用。这可能是因为PHP扩展模块没有正确安装或配置导致的。解决方法是检查PHP配置文件中的扩展模块加载项是否正确,并确保扩展模块已经安装。2. PHP文件被篡改:有时候我们发现PHP网页无法正常访问,或者存在异常操作。这可能是因为PHP文件被篡改导致的。解决方法是及时备份重要的PHP文件,并使用安全措施保护PHP文件的完整性,如设置文件权限等。
3. PHP变量丢失:有时候我们在使用PHP变量时发现变量无法正常传递或存储。这可能是因为变量作用域、变量命名冲突等问题导致的。解决方法是确保变量作用域正确,避免命名冲突,并使用适当的变量声明和赋值方式。
4. PHP错误提示关闭:有时候我们在运行PHP代码时没有得到任何错误提示,导致无法准确判断错误原因。这可能是因为PHP错误报告功能没有开启或配置不正确。解决方法是检查PHP配置文件中的error_reporting和display_errors选项,并确保其值正确设置。
二、解决PHP丢失问题的方法:
1. 检查PHP配置:检查PHP配置文件,确认扩展模块加载项、错误报告设置等是否正确。2. 更新PHP版本:有时候PHP丢失问题是由于PHP版本过旧或存在bug导致的。可以尝试升级到最新稳定版的PHP版本,以修复可能存在的问题。
3. 检查错误日志:查看PHP错误日志,分析错误信息,根据错误信息定位问题所在,并采取相应的解决措施。
4. 使用调试工具:可以使用PHP调试工具来诊断和修复PHP丢失问题。常用的调试工具有Xdebug、PhpStorm等,可以通过设置断点、观察变量值等方式定位问题。
5. 学习PHP相关知识:了解PHP的基本语法和常见问题,并掌握一些常用的调试技巧,能够更快速准确地解决PHP丢失问题。
综上所述,当遇到PHP丢失问题时,我们可以通过检查PHP配置、更新PHP版本、查看错误日志、使用调试工具以及学习相关知识等方法来解决问题。同时,也需要保持代码的规范性和安全性,以降低PHP丢失问题的发生几率。
2年前 -
PHP丢失通常是指在运行PHP代码时出现错误或无法找到所需的PHP文件或函数。解决此类问题可以尝试以下几种方法:
1. 检查PHP安装:首先,确保已正确安装PHP并将其路径添加到系统环境变量中,这样系统才能正确找到PHP解释器。可以在命令行中输入”php -v”来检查PHP的安装情况。
2. 检查PHP配置:确认PHP配置文件(php.ini)中的相关设置是否正确。特别是检查以下几个方面:
– 确保”extension_dir”设置正确,指向PHP扩展库的路径。
– 确保”error_reporting”设置为显示所有错误和警告信息。
– 确保”include_path”设置包含所需的PHP文件路径。3. 检查PHP文件路径:如果无法找到某个PHP文件或函数,可以先确认文件是否存在,然后检查文件路径是否正确。可以使用绝对路径或相对路径来指定文件位置。
4. 检查PHP版本兼容性:有些PHP代码或函数可能只适用于特定的PHP版本。确保代码和函数与当前使用的PHP版本兼容。
5. 检查错误日志:如果PHP代码在执行时出错,可以查看PHP错误日志以获取更多详细信息。错误日志通常位于PHP安装目录的”logs”文件夹中,文件名为”php_error.log”或类似的名称。检查错误日志可以帮助确定具体的问题所在。
如果问题仍然存在,可以参考PHP官方文档、各种PHP技术论坛或社区,寻求更详细的解决方案。
2年前 -
PHP文件丢失是指在使用PHP开发过程中,由于某种原因导致了PHP文件的丢失,无法找到或者无法访问到。这可能会导致网站功能异常或者无法正常运行。接下来,我将从方法和操作流程两个方面介绍解决PHP丢失的方法。
一、解决方案方法
1. 恢复文件
– 通过备份文件恢复:如果你有备份文件,可以通过将备份文件恢复到正常路径来解决PHP文件丢失的问题。
– 从其他环境中复制:如果你在其他环境中有相同的PHP文件,可以将文件复制到正常路径中。
– 重新下载或复制:如果你使用的是开源框架或者库,可以重新下载或复制相应的文件到正常路径中。2. 检查文件权限
– 确保文件权限正确:请确保PHP文件的权限设置正确,一般可以将文件权限设置为644,目录权限设置为755。3. 查找丢失文件
– 使用文件搜索工具:可以使用文件搜索工具(如Linux下的find命令或Windows下的Everything工具)来搜索系统中的PHP文件。
– 查看日志文件:如果你有日志文件,并且在文件丢失时有记录,可以查看日志文件,找到可能丢失的文件路径。4. 检查文件引用
– 确认引用路径正确:如果PHP文件被其他文件引用,确保引用路径正确,确保路径和文件名的大小写一致。5. 恢复文件内容
– 从备份中恢复内容:如果你有备份文件,可以从备份中恢复PHP文件的内容。
– 通过其他方式获取文件内容:如果文件内容丢失,可以尝试通过其他途径获取文件内容,如向开发者或者其他同行请求文件内容。二、操作流程
1. 确认文件丢失
– 检查网站功能:检查网站是否出现功能异常或无法正常运行的情况。
– 检查相关错误日志:查看相关错误日志,确认是否有文件丢失的记录。2. 查找文件路径
– 使用文件搜索工具:使用文件搜索工具,搜索系统中可能丢失的PHP文件。
– 查看日志文件:如果有日志文件,并且在文件丢失时有记录,查看日志文件,找到可能丢失的文件路径。3. 恢复文件
– 通过备份恢复:如果有备份文件,将备份文件恢复到正常路径中。
– 从其他环境中复制:如果在其他环境中有相同的PHP文件,将文件复制到正常路径中。4. 检查文件引用
– 确认引用路径正确:如果文件被其他文件引用,确保引用路径正确,与实际文件路径一致。5. 检查文件权限
– 确保文件权限正确:检查PHP文件的权限设置,确保文件权限正确,一般为644,目录权限为755。6. 测试网站功能
– 检查网站功能:重新测试网站功能,确认是否能正常访问和使用。总结:解决PHP文件丢失的方法包括恢复文件、检查文件权限、查找丢失文件、检查文件引用和恢复文件内容等方面。在操作流程中,需要确认文件丢失,查找文件路径,恢复文件,检查文件引用,检查文件权限和测试网站功能等步骤。通过以上方法和操作流程,可以有效解决PHP文件丢失的问题。
2年前